Intelligent Logistics Distribution Mode of "Delivery Vehicle + Drone"

In view of the current logistics needs and the development of drone product technology, this paper systematically summarized the current situation of "delivery vehicle+drone" logistics distribution, the application scenarios and characteristics of delivery vehicles and drones, the mode and benefits of joint logistics distribution, the software, hardware and algorithms involved and other core technologies. Then the paper made the suggestion of further more design from the aspects of drones, vehicle loads, intelligent path planning, portal websites, safety, etc. Combined with the differences in transportation scenarios between urban and rural areas, as well as differences in the variety of transportation items, a targeted and differentiated operation and management mode was proposed. The current risks faced by the industry such as unmatched laws and regulations, immature industries, operational security, and data privacy were analyzed, and targeted suggestions were proposed from the perspectives of legal norms, technology platforms, green and low-carbon, multi-scenario collaboration, and assessment.
